History
Classification:
a. Schooner, Bay City (1853-1859)
Nationality:
American (1853-1859)
Chronology:
1. 12/00/1856, Sandusky, struck a bar, sprang a leak, repaired, $1, 000 loss;
2. 11/16/1859, East Sister Reef, ashore, (corn), hull went to pieces, hull $6, 200 loss, cargo $300 loss;
